Osteoarthritis and osteoarthritis – a degenerative disease of the joints, causing pain and loss of mobility. This is not a passive phenomenon of “wear and tear, it was thought until recently, and the active disease with underlying complex diseases.
Earlier treatment of osteoarthritis and osteoarthritis was limited to symptomatic (aimed at reducing the external manifestations of the disease, in fact, already the consequences of the pathological process), and virtually no regard to the impact on the causes of the disease. Most frequently used non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s and the ineffectiveness of recent corticosteroid hormones. However, these drugs are not always effective, many are contraindicated and have lots of complications, in addition, many of them that do not stop, but rather, even intensify the destruction of articular cartilage. Widely used physical therapy, although it has some positive effect, but can not be regarded as quite adequate for this pathology.
Thus, virtually all treatment earlier is to limit physical exertion, wearing various types of elastic bandages, which most often leads to further progression of the disease, the need for patient use a cane, crutches.
Violations of hyaluronic acid homeostasis in the pathogenesis of osteoarthritis and osteoarthritis:
Synovial fluid was detected in all synovial joints, particularly in heavy load-bearing joints, where it provides a normal pain-free movement because of its lubricating and cushioning properties.
Hyaluronic acid is a natural polymer that provides the viscoelastic properties of synovial fluid. In a normal joint, it has a high concentration in the surface layer of articular cartilage, as well as the surface layers of the synovial membrane. In synovial fluid hyaluronic acid acts as a lubricant and shock absorber, located between energonakaplivayuschy agent against each other cartilages, semipermeable barrier that regulates the metabolic exchanges between the cartilage and synovial fluid, the agent that manages the movement of cells and viscoelastic screen around sinoviotsitov and adjacent nerve endings, it also responsible for nutrition of cartilage.
Healthy synovial joint is in a state of equilibrium or homeostasis. Hyaluronic acid is constantly moving in a joint cavity, but its concentration and the profile of the molecular weight remains constant.
In the case of disorders associated with joint damage, such as osteoarthritis and osteoarthritis, hyaluronic acid is depolymerized in the space of joint and split. Homeostasis is disturbed. Synovial fluid becomes less viscous and lubricating, shock-absorbing and filtering capabilities are reduced.
The cover layer of hyaluronic acid on the surface of the joint is destroyed, leaving the cartilage and synovial membrane vulnerable to mechanical and inflammatory lesions.
Synovium becomes inflamed and permeable to inflammatory molecules, which because of it can penetrate into the joint in large quantities.
This leads to increased mechanical stress on joints and cartilage destruction, which ultimately leads to pain and limited mobility of the damaged joint.
Adding with intraarticular injections of highly purified hyaluronic acid can improve the viscoelastic properties of synovial fluid. This increases the lubricating and shock absorbing function and reduces mechanical stress on the joint. Typically, this leads to a decrease in pain and increase joint mobility, which can last for at least several months after the treatment cycle, including five of intraarticular injection.
Active-active substance:
Hyaluronic acid / sodium hyaluronate / Gilan / hyaluronan / Sodium hyaluronate.
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) Properties / Action:
Sodium hyaluronate (Gilan, a biological analogue of hyaluronan) – is a polysaccharide composed of repeating disaccharide units N-atsetilglikozamina glyukuronata and sodium. Has a high molecular weight. 1% solution of sodium hyaluronate is a hydrated gel.
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) for intra-articular injection:
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) is used as a sterile viscoelastic implant for intra-articular injection in the synovial space in patients with mild or moderate osteoarthritis or osteoarthrosis. It is used for the treatment of knee or any other synovial joints.
In fact, is an analogue of human synovial fluid. On this basis, the introduction of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) in the affected joint breaks a key part of development of osteoarthritis, there is an influence is the cause of the progression of osteoarthritis.
Therapeutic effect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) is associated with the completion of the viscosity, whereby the improved rheological and physiological status of tissues of the affected joint. In addition, the effect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) is based on the effect of “trigger mechanism” – the ability to directly restore the joint to produce endogenous hyaluronan and thus returns to a state of homeostasis, which persists for several months.
As shown by the accumulated clinical materials, the application of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an), the following points:
• restores synovial equilibrium: it increases the viscosity of synovial fluid its lubricating restoring, shock absorb and filtration properties;
• protects articular cartilage from mechanical and chemical damage: restores protective coating on the inner surface of the joint and increases the binding of free radicals;
• inflammation of the synovial membrane and decreases its protective function be restored.
Slowing the destruction of articular cartilage in conjunction with the processes of restoration of homeostasis of synovial fluid lead to a rapid withdrawal of pain symptoms and regression phenomena limited mobility in the joint.
Beneficial effect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) appears gradually during the course and persist for several months. After passing through the full course of 5 injections symptoms are usually removed for a period of 6 to 12 months.
Indications:
For intra-articular injection:
• for pain and limited mobility due to degenerative-dystrophic and traumatic changes of the knee, hip and other synovial joints;
• for the temporary replacement and replenishment of synovial fluid;
• in the treatment of patients with active lifestyle and regularly load on the affected joint.
For intraocular injections (eye surgery):
• Expansion of the anterior chamber or division of tissue, etc. (with operations in the anterior and posterior segments of the eye);
• examination of the retina during and after surgery;
• Conduct laser therapy (adjuvant).
Contraindications:
General:
• Individual intolerance (including history of hypersensitivity) Hyaluronan
For intra-articular injection:
• Presence of infected wounds, sores in the joint;
• infected or severely inflamed joints;
• venous or lymphatic stasis in the side of the affected joint.
Not recommended introduction to cupping events synovitis in mind the dilution of the preparation of synovial fluid and possible reduction in therapeutic effect.
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) is not recommended for use by pregnant women and nursing mothers, as well as patients suffering from inflammatory diseases such as rheumatoid arthritis and Bechterew’s disease.
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) Side effects:
For intra-articular injection:
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) is characterized by excellent tolerance. In clinical studies showed a complete absence of toxic and mutagenic reactions. Due to the shape registration – syringe pen – minimizes the possibility of entry of a secondary infection at the injection.
Possible side effects (usually completely disappear within a few days):
• Local secondary phenomena, such as pain, feeling of warmth, redness and swelling may occur at the joint, which introduced the drug (applying ice to the joint for five – ten minutes will remove all such events);
• the emergence of intra-articular exudation (in some cases, exudation may be significant and cause more prolonged pain) in these cases it is necessary to produce a puncture of the joint and removing fluid from it followed by microscopy to exclude infection and microcrystalline arthropathy (gout);
• extremely rare – allergic reactions.
Special warnings and precautions:
For intra-articular injection:
Some of the drugs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) contain small amounts of chicken protein, and therefore the treatment of patients with hypersensitivity appropriate caution. Particular attention should be patients suffering from hypersensitivity towards drugs.
Do not enter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) in the presence of significant intra-articular effusion.
Please follow the general precautions for intra-articular injections. In processing the skin prior to injection can not use disinfectants containing quaternary ammonium salts.
Before the introduction of the solution should be warmed to room temperature.
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) must be carefully introduced into the joint cavity. You can not enter ekstraartikulyarno, including, in the synovial tissue or joint capsule. In this case, there may be local adverse reactions. Need to avoid getting the drug into the blood vessels!
As well as after any other invasive procedures on the joints, after injection of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an), the patient is recommended to adhere to gentle treatment and avoid unnecessary burdens on the joint for several days.
Do not use the drug if the pre-filled syringe or sterile packaging is damaged.
The effectiveness of treatment, comprising less than three injections, has not been established.
Efficacy and safety of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) when applying for other indications, except for osteoarthritis or osteoarthritis, has not been established.
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) is not used for the treatment of pregnant women and children under 18 years old.
During the course of treatment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) is not allowed entry into the cavity of the affected joint anesthetics or other pharmacologic agents.
Drug Interactions:
For intra-articular injection:
To date, no information concerning the incompatibility of Orthovisc Injections (Hyaluronan) with other solutions for intra-articular use. To facilitate the condition of the patient can take oral analgesics or anti-inflammatory drugs during the first few days of treatments.
